Diferente pentru monthly-2014/runda-3/solutii intre reviziile #4 si #5

Nu exista diferente intre titluri.

Diferente intre continut:

h1. Solutii Infoarena Monthly 2014 - Runda 3
==Include(page="template/monthly-2014")==
(toc)*{text-align:center} *Lista de probleme*
* 'Beep':monthly-2014/runda-3/solutii#beep
* 'Bancomat':monthly-2014/runda-3/solutii#bancomat
* 'Basequery':monthly-2014/runda-3/solutii#basequery
* 'Concert2':monthly-2014/runda-3/solutii#concert2
h1. 'Bancomat':problema/bancomat
==include(page="monthly-2014/runda-3/solutii/beep")==
Bancnotele de valori mici vor fi păstrate pentru a "completa" suma cerută de un client. Mai exact, dacă un client doreşte să extragă $364$ de bani din bancomat, suma de $4$ bani poate fi obţinută doar din bancnote de $1$ ban. Intuitiv, trebuie să păstrăm bancnotele cu valoare mică pentru rezolvarea acestor cazuri. Vom oferi suma de bani cerută de fiecare client în parte în mod optim, folosind monedele, în ordinea descrescătoare a valorii acestora. Vom "umple" fiecare sumă de bani $X$ mai întâi cu bancnote de $500$ lei, apoi de $100$ lei, $50$ lei, etc. Dacă nu putem să oferim suma cerută de un om, vom returna $NU$.
==include(page="monthly-2014/runda-3/solutii/bancomat")==
h1. 'Basequery':problema/basequery
==include(page="monthly-2014/runda-3/solutii/basequery")==
h1. 'Beep':problema/beep
==include(page="monthly-2014/runda-3/solutii/concert2")==
Vom citi cuvântul interzis. Vom citi apoi fiecare cuvânt în parte din textul care trebuie corectat. Comparăm fiecare cuvânt citit cu cel interzis. Dacă sunt egale, vom afişa "beep". În caz contrar, vom afişa chiar cuvântul citit.
 
==include(page="template/monthly-2014/footer")==

Nu exista diferente intre securitate.

Topicul de forum nu a fost schimbat.